If you are not a coffee drinker, some tea or even just hot water with a little lemon will help get you going in the morning. WebAug 29, 2024 · Cheese Sandwich. Another meat-free option is the cheese sandwich, which lends the carbs, fat and protein to support a long day hike. These are easily gussied up with a switch in bread (try English muffins, bagels or flatbreads) or the addition of herbs and spices. A caprese sandwich can easily be made more exciting if prepared on focaccia ...
